info:sek-ii:q2:sql:sql-island-tipps
SQL Island: Tipps
# | Befehl |
---|---|
1 | SELECT * FROM dorf |
2 | SELECT * FROM bewohner |
3 | SELECT * FROM bewohner WHERE beruf = 'Metzger' |
4 | SELECT * FROM bewohner WHERE STATUS = 'friedlich' |
5 | SELECT * FROM bewohner WHERE beruf = "Waffenschmied" AND STATUS = "friedlich" |
6 | SELECT * FROM bewohner WHERE beruf LIKE "%schmied" AND STATUS = "friedlich" |
7 | INSERT INTO bewohner (name, dorfnr, geschlecht, beruf, gold, STATUS) VALUES ('Fremder', 1, '?', '?', 0, '?') |
8 | SELECT bewohnernr FROM bewohner WHERE name = "Fremder" |
9 | SELECT gold FROM bewohner WHERE name = "Fremder" |
10 | SELECT * FROM gegenstand WHERE besitzer IS NULL |
11 | UPDATE gegenstand SET besitzer = 20 WHERE gegenstand = 'Kaffeetasse' |
12 | UPDATE gegenstand SET besitzer = 20 WHERE besitzer IS NULL |
13 | SELECT * FROM gegenstand WHERE besitzer = 20 |
14 | SELECT * FROM bewohner WHERE STATUS = "friedlich" AND (beruf = "Haendler" OR beruf = "Kaufmann") |
15 | UPDATE gegenstand SET besitzer = 15 WHERE gegenstand = "Ring" OR gegenstand = "Teekanne" |
16 | UPDATE bewohner SET gold = gold + 120 WHERE bewohnernr = 20 |
17 | UPDATE bewohner SET name = "Horst Horstmann" WHERE bewohnernr = 20 |
18 | SELECT * FROM bewohner WHERE beruf = "Bäcker" ORDER BY name |
19 | UPDATE bewohner SET gold = gold + 100 - 150 WHERE bewohnernr = 20 |
20 | INSERT INTO gegenstand (gegenstand, besitzer) VALUES ('Schwert', 20) |
21 | SELECT * FROM bewohner WHERE beruf = "Pilot" |
22 | SELECT dorf.name FROM dorf, bewohner WHERE dorf.dorfnr = bewohner.dorfnr AND bewohner.name = 'Dirty Dieter' |
23 | SELECT bewohner.name FROM bewohner, dorf WHERE bewohner.bewohnernr = dorf.haeuptling AND dorf.name = "Zwiebelhausen" |
24 | SELECT COUNT(*) FROM bewohner, dorf WHERE dorf.dorfnr = bewohner.dorfnr AND dorf.name = 'Zwiebelhausen' |
25 | SELECT COUNT(*) FROM bewohner, dorf WHERE dorf.dorfnr = bewohner.dorfnr AND dorf.name = 'Zwiebelhausen' AND geschlecht = "w" |
26 | SELECT bewohner.name FROM bewohner, dorf WHERE dorf.dorfnr = bewohner.dorfnr AND dorf.name = 'Zwiebelhausen' AND geschlecht = "w" |
27 | SELECT SUM(bewohner.gold) FROM bewohner, dorf WHERE dorf.dorfnr = bewohner.dorfnr AND dorf.name = 'Gurkendorf' |
28 | SELECT SUM(bewohner.gold) FROM bewohner WHERE bewohner.beruf IN ("Haendler", "Kaufmann", "Baecker") |
29 | SELECT beruf, SUM(bewohner.gold), AVG(bewohner.gold) FROM bewohner GROUP BY beruf ORDER BY AVG(bewohner.gold) |
30 | SELECT STATUS, AVG(bewohner.gold) FROM bewohner GROUP BY STATUS ORDER BY AVG(bewohner.gold) |
31 | DELETE FROM bewohner WHERE name = 'Dirty Dieter' |
32 | DELETE FROM bewohner WHERE name = 'Dirty Doerthe' |
33 | UPDATE bewohner SET STATUS = "friedlich" WHERE beruf = "Pilot" |
34 | UPDATE bewohner SET STATUS = 'ausgewandert' WHERE bewohnernr = 20 |
info/sek-ii/q2/sql/sql-island-tipps.txt · Zuletzt geändert: 2020-02-11 17:19 von christian.weber